Job description

Here at SmartFlow Services, we’re an established and growing Plumbing, Water Supply, and Gas Heating Repair & Installation specialist, who are looking for dynamic Plumbing professionals to grow with us. We specialise in Emergency Domestic Plumbing and Heating Repairs, meaning no two days are the same, and we offer a very attractive uncapped bonus scheme for those who excel in getting the job done right first time and with the highest standards of Customer Service.

Ideally, you’re based in a DE or NG postcode area, and must be willing to travel across the DE, NG, ST, and LE areas, with travel to other postcode areas required on an ad hoc basis. We’ll provide the van and cover your fuel costs of course, and you’ll have a generous supply of spares.

We pride ourselves on offering our customer’s the very best Customer Experience, and that needs to be a priority for you too.

Working hours are Monday – Friday 8am-5pm and 1 weekend day every 3 weeks. When you work a day at the weekend you can either have a day off in lieu during the week, or you can claim it as overtime; it’s entirely up to you.

SKILLS REQUIRED:

- 5 years post apprentice qualified experience

- Ability to manage van stock & parts/materials

- Own tools

- Excellent customer service skills & smart appearance

- Punctual, reliable, and honest

- Highly motivated and flexible

- Recent CRB check (or willing to apply)

- Full UK driving licence

- Qualification Certificates Plumber NVQ or equivalent (ideal but not essential)
